Ord Reality
The ord indexer requires an archival Bitcoin Core underneath and builds its own index of every satoshi and inscription on-chain. Storage requirements have grown significantly with inscription adoption. Plan 500GB+ on top of Bitcoin Core for serious ord operation in 2026.
Hardware Match
NVMe is mandatory; the index is heavily random-IO bound. Our 2TB upgrade is recommended for ord operators. 16GB RAM minimum, 32GB recommended for snappy queries.
